PSLE The graph shows the number of macarons sold each month by a new bakery from July to December.
- How many more macarons were sold in October than in August?
- What was the percentage increase in the number of macarons sold in November compared to July?
(a)
Number of macarons sold in August = 140
Number of macarons sold in October = 300
Number of more macarons sold in October than in August
= 300 - 140
= 160
(b)
Number of macarons sold in July = 50
Number of macarons sold in November = 370
Increase in the number of macarons sold in November compared to July
= 370 - 50
= 320
Percentage increase in the number of macarons sold in November compared to July
=
32050 x 100%
= 640%
Answer(s): (a) 160; (b) 640%
